Rob, I was told the SS2 should be more brown...... but I followed the Mike Starmer formula (the recognised authority of course) converting the humbrol to lifecolor and ended up with this shade, its like something that came out of a fresh nappy/diaper. But totally agree with your re paint colours and their mixes and then subsequent weathering. SS2 varied apparently due to shortages, they were looking for a more green shade but could never produce enough due to lack of green pigments at the time. but as a project its one I'm pretty happy with.

Another project, this one is close to the end of construction, Dragon early Jagdpanther base, with Atak zimmerit, Griffon etch and an Aber barrel, I have tried to use Bronco's indie tracks but the pitch is slightly off and doesn't fit the sprocket, so may have to use the magic tracks.
